Devils Fall to Cougars in Season Finale

Box Score MADISON, N.J. – The FDU-Florham Devils 2013 season came to an end on Saturday afternoon at Robert T. Shields Field as they were defeated 63-40 by the Misericordia University Cougars.

The win for the Cougars is the first in the program's two-year history. Misericordia and FDU-Florham finish the campaign with matching 1-9 records.

Misericordia junior quarterback Jeff Puckett rushed for a program-high six touchdowns and totaled 160 yards on 26 carries in the win.

Cougar tailback Frank Santarsiero rushed 25 times for 222 yards and three scores of his own as MU totaled nine ground-scores on the afternoon.

Devils senior wide receiver Anthony Fruncillo (Tinton Falls, N.J./Monmouth Regional) hauled in 12 receptions for 111 yards and three scores in the loss. Fruncillo also added six carries for 29 yards and a rushing touchdown in his final game as a Devil.

Today's game was a shootout from the start, as the Cougars opened the game with a four-play, 54-yard touchdown drive that took just 51 seconds. The drive was capped by a four-yard plunge from Puckett.

On the Devils first play from scrimmage, quarterback Mike Santos' (North Arlington, N.J./St. Mary's) pass was intercepted by Cougar defensive end Cory Dickerson and was brought down to the FDU-Florham 7-yard line.  Puckett rushed in on the next play to provide the Cougars a 14-0 advantage with 13:44 still remaining in the opening quarter.

On the second play of FDU-Florham's next possession, tailback Craig Kimbrough (Dover, N.J./Morris Catholic) broke free for a 56-yard touchdown run to get the Devils on the board.

The Cougars countered with an eight-play, 73-yard march on the ensuing possession to build a 21-6 lead with 1:52 to play in the first quarter.

After forcing an FDU-Florham punt, the Misericordia attack went back to work and Puckett found the end zone for the third time, increasing the Cougar lead to 28-6.

The Devils rallied back courtesy of two touchdown strikes from Santos to Fruncillo, from three and 14 yards out respectively, to cut the Misericordia lead to 28-20 with 12:20 to play in the half.

The two teams traded touchdowns equating to a 35-27 Cougar lead. Puckett's fifth rushing touchdown of the first half built the Misericordia lead to 42-27 with 2:16 remaining in the second quarter.

With 53 seconds remaining in the opening half, Santos found Fruncillo on a 14-yard connection to bring the Devils back within one score.

Both teams went three-and-out on their opening possessions of the second half before the Devils put together their best drive of the afternoon. Santos hooked up with senior tight end Doug Van Orden (Madison, N.J./Madison) on a 16-yard slant capping a 12-play, 70-yard FDUF drive. A botched snap on the point-after try, resulted in a 42-40 game with 4:58 remaining in the third quarter.

The Cougars proceeded to score 21 unanswered points thanks to two touchdown rushes by Santarsiero and one from Puckett, equating to the 63-40 final.

Misericordia totaled an impressive 408 rushing yards in the game, while the two teams combined totaled over 1,000 yards on the day.

Santos tossed for 274 yards and four touchdowns in his final game as a Devil.

Devils senior linebacker Mike Mancino (Weston, Fla./Cypress Bay) totaled a remarkable 19 tackles in the loss giving him 116 on the season, which ranks him fourth all-time in FDU-Florham single-season history.
